There are a number of components to contemplate when buying firewood if you need to get by far the most for your money. Many of these are listed and discussed below to help you acquire the right wood in your case and many of all help you remain warm.

Is usually a fireplace your only form of heating?
If so you will want extra Wooden than the usual house that also makes use of a heat pump
What dimension would be the place or dwelling that you'll be heating?
A bigger House will require additional Wooden to heat it - take into account the peak of your ceilings at the same time.
How big is your firebox?

This will likely dictate the dimensions with the firewood it is possible to melt away, we inventory A variety of in a different way sized woods to suit all needs.

How perfectly insulated is your property?
A nicely-insulated home and double glazed Home windows assistance to keep the warmth, indicating you must have to have much less Wooden to warmth your private home.
Do you might have an open hearth or could it be enclosed?
An open up hearth will shed a lot of heat straight up the chimney (up to 70%) so you need to burn up extra wood to have the very same heat as you'll from the log burner. Also, you will discover specific woods to avoid on open fires as they will spit and spark which may damage the ground within the hearth and is particularly a fire threat.
How long will you be burning your fire for on a daily basis?
If you are burning your fireplace for extensive periods of time (many of the working day) Then you really will want more hardwood as this puts out much more heat than softwood and burns for for a longer time (so no topping up the fireplace every single 30 minutes). If you're only burning the fire inside the evenings (or only a few hours each day) you'll want nearer to the fifty/fifty mixture of difficult to softwood.

The different types of firewood
Differing kinds of firewood? but wood is wood, right? Completely wrong, not all Wooden was developed equal! There's two major forms of wood, softwood, and hardwood.

Softwood

Is speedy-rising and has a decrease density
Incorporates a lesser ratio of heartwood to sapwood than hardwoods - heartwood provides more warmth than sapwood when burnt
Reduce density woods are much easier to mild and begin a fire with. It also is easier to break up and lighter to manage
Burns faster than hardwood and doesnt give off as much warmth
Seasons faster than hardwood but is a lot more vulnerable to having moisture back again on at the time dry

Hardwood

Normally takes lengthier to grow than softwood
Has a better density
Burns for longer and puts out additional warmth
Requires extended to time but has a lot more dampness resistance than softwoods
Has the next ratio of heartwood than softwoods
Heavier and tougher to separate than softwoods
What exactly need to I invest in?
The standard household through a mean Wintertime in Dunedin will use in between 6-10 cubic meters of wood. We suggest burning hardwood as much as you possibly can as this gives you a lot more heat per log which means you don't need to acquire as much Wooden, you needn't stack as much Wooden, and likewise you will not be topping the fireplace up every single 10 minutes since it burns slower, so fewer trips to the woodpile on those chilly Winter get more info season evenings.

For the domestic that burns the hearth almost all of the day an excellent ratio of difficult/softwood (burning Wooden and starter Wooden) is 80/20 respectively. If You merely burn up your fire a handful of hrs each day then you will want nearer to some fifty/50 combination of wood.
